Today the Alligators garden has gone back in time by millions of years and has now transferred to Dinosaur Land.
The children are welcomed by Miss Nadya and Miss Alix as well as T-Rex and his friends in a botanical garden for the children to explore. The children enjoy digging in the soil, trudging the dinosaurs through the mud and stomping in the leaves.
Inside the classroom, there are various table top activities for the children to investigate and learn. Some of us are making dinosaur footprint artwork by dipping the dinosaurs into the paint. There are other children playing “mummy’s and daddy’s” in our living room role-play area. Mummy is busy ironing some clothes and watering our plants on the shelf, whilst daddy is busy sweeping the floor and dusting the furniture.
There is a number game taking place on the carpet with a big set of dice and number mats, where some of the class are practicing our counting and number recognition.
It is now time for us to get ready for a snack. We all help tidy up the toys using our special tidy up song. We did such a great job!
We all sit down for circle time and do our self- registration activity to see who is in our class today. Our special helper of the day puts out our snack mats on the table as we all wash our hands and sit down at the table for our healthy snacks.
Singing with Archie is next! Our special helper leads the class into the reception area to join our friends to sing along an dance to our favourite songs.
We make our way to the kitchen to become mini chefs for the latter part of our morning. We are making Mexican salsa today, a recipe one of our mums has brought in for us. We get busy exploring our colourful vegetables, taking turns to chop, squeeze, grate and mix our ingredients together. The finished result is a tasty, zesty salsa, sprinkled onto tortilla chips.
We end our busy morning with a story chosen by our Special Helper. They have picked “there’s a lion in my cornflakes”, one of our new favourites. While the story is read to the children, a new idea transforms for another exciting adventure tomorrow………
